Why Condensed Fonts Matter for Modern Design
In the competitive world of graphic design, choosing the right font can make or break a project. Condensed fonts have become increasingly popular, as they pack a visual punch while saving valuable space. Whether in advertising, branding, or digital media, these fonts enable designers to make strong statements without clutter, ensuring the message stands out. The appeal of condensed fonts lies in their versatility; they fit beautifully into both larger headlines and nuanced text, making them essential tools for graphic designers everywhere.

Choosing the Right Font: Tips for Designers
When selecting a condensed font, consider the project’s message and audience. For instance, while fonts like Clampdown work fabulously for bold advertisements, others like Robern might suit a more delicate invitation card design. It’s essential to ensure that the font is readable at the sizes you’ll be using, especially for smaller text applications. Consistent experimentation with different pairings will yield the best results in typography.
